Frequently Asked Questions
How many Wh is 953,531 mAh?
953,531 mAh equals 3,528.0647 Wh at 3.7V (Li-ion nominal voltage). The exact Wh depends on the battery voltage: Wh = mAh × V / 1,000.
How do I convert 953,531 mAh to Wh?
Multiply 953,531 by the battery voltage, then divide by 1,000. At 3.7V: 953,531 × 3.7 / 1,000 = 3,528.0647 Wh.
Is 953,531 mAh allowed on a plane?
At 3.7V, 953,531 mAh = 3,528.0647 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
